How were chariot drivers protected in the Circus Maximus

Respuesta :

avrilmorris12
avrilmorris12 avrilmorris12
  • 04-04-2014
They wore knee pads and shoulder pads and chest pads and carried a pocket knife around with them if they were to get tangled in the reins on the chariot and get trampled on. Oh and don't forget a shiny hard helmet
